David Blake – West Coast Contender – Primed for Pan Am and Beyond

2024-10-12T17:54:57-04:00March 9, 2011|DressageDaily, Looking Back, Markel Insurance, News||

Blake earned his gold medal in 2000 and purchased his first horse Catapult from Suze Randall in Malibu, CA. With Catapult, he won the Markel/USEF National FEI 6-year-old Championships in Lexington, KY in 2006. In 2007, he purchased Lord Albert from Sharon Garner and won the West Coast FEI 5-year-old [...]

From Young Rider Ranks to National Success

2024-10-11T21:57:36-04:00January 28, 2011|DressageDaily, Looking Back, Markel Insurance, News||

Growing up in a horsey Massachusetts town, Caroline Roffman’s earliest riding experiences were “backyard” outings hunter pacing and pony club events. “At 10 my mom thought I was ready for my first horse, an older bay gelding in his twenties named, Dijon,” she said. Today, her riding has excelled far [...]
